Hazell is a surname, most frequently recorded in the United Kingdom. In St. Vincent & Grenadines it is the 36th most common surname. It appears chiefly in English and Welsh, written in the Latin script. Recorded meaning: Person who lives by a hazel tree or grove.

Frequently asked questions

How common is the name Hazell?
We estimate roughly 1.6 thousand people bear Hazell (counting its spellings and scripts) across 13 countries in our records.
In which country does Hazell have the most bearers?
Hazell is most frequently recorded in the United Kingdom, where it is most often spelled hazell.
Where is Hazell most common?
Measured as a share of residents rather than as a count, Hazell is densest in St. Vincent & Grenadines — about 1 in 322 people — even though United Kingdom holds more of our records for it.
How common is Hazell compared with other names?
In St. Vincent & Grenadines, Hazell is the 36th most common surname of 1,182 surnames recorded there.
What does the name Hazell mean?
Recorded meaning: Person who lives by a hazel tree or grove.
